Abstract
Traditional studies of memristive devices have mainly focused on their applications in non-volatile information storage and information processing. Here, we demonstrate that the third fundamental component of information technologies { the transfer of information { can also be employed with memristive devices. For this purpose, we introduce a metastable memristive circuit. Combining metastable memristive circuits into a line, one obtains an architecture capable of transferring a signal edge from one space location to another. We emphasize that the suggested transmission lines employ only resistive components. Moreover, their networks (for example, Y-connected lines) have an information processing capability.
